LARKANA: Bandits snatch judge’s car

Published October 21, 2002

LARKANA, Oct 20: Bandits snatched the car of the additional sessions judge, Kandhkot, Ghulam Ali Samtio, near Sultan Samtio village in the jurisdiction of Dokri police station.

The police later picked up some suspects after the car was tracked to Naudgoth village near Wagan town.

Hunter killed: A man, Taj Mohammed Marfani, was shot dead while hunting in the Drigh Lake on Saturday, police said.

The killers escaped, leaving the body behind, which the police recovered after the local people spotted it.

An old enmity had led to the killing, the police opined, adding that they had registered an FIR on the compliant of the deceased’s father against Salih Chandio, Gulzar, Gullo and the others.

SNF: The central committee of the Sindh National Front (SNF) held a meeting here on Sunday, which was presided over by Mumtaz Ali Bhutto.

The meeting took stock of the post-poll scenario, the party’s deputy secretary general, information, Mohammed Ayoub Shar said.
